"Pup Champs: Adorable Football Puzzler frappe iOS, Android bientôt"

Auteur:Kristen Mise à jour:May 15,2025

Préparez-vous pour une délicieuse tournure au genre de football avec des champions de chiots , une sortie à venir pour iOS et Android qui combine le charme des adorables chiots avec l'excitation du football. Lancement le 19 mai, ce jeu n'est pas votre simulateur de sport typique; Au lieu de cela, c'est un puzzler captivant qui vous met au défi de guider votre équipe vers le but à travers des passes stratégiques et des croix, tout en esquivant les plaqués de l'équipe adverse.

Conçus pour être accessibles à tout le monde, même ceux qui ne connaissent pas la règle de hors-jeu du football, Pup Champs offre une expérience engageante pour les fans occasionnels et les joueurs chevronnés. Le jeu présente également une histoire inspirante de l'opprimé, où vous entrez dans les chaussures d'un entraîneur de football à la retraite pour encadrer une équipe de jeunes chiots dans leur voyage pour devenir champions de football amateur.

Pup Champs sera disponible en tant que jeu gratuit, offrant initialement 20 puzzles pour lancer votre aventure. Bien que le concept de mélanger les chiots avec le football puisse sembler être un ajustement naturel dans notre monde obsédé par la gentillesse, surtout compte tenu de la popularité d'événements comme le chiot et le bol de chaton, les champions de chiot se démarquent en se concentrant sur la résolution de puzzle plutôt que sur la simulation sportive.

Développé par Afterburn, l'équipe derrière des titres acclamés tels que Railbound, Golf Peaks et Pulsar, Pup Champs promet à la fois le style et la substance. Ce puzzler mignon mais habile devrait avoir un impact significatif sur la scène des jeux mobiles.
